Full Description
Coin of Magnentius (S1) Pt.ii AE2 AD 351-3. Obverse: DN. MAGNEN-TIVS P.F.AVG M. M. A. Reverse: VICTORIAE DD. NN. AVG.ET CAE.
Shield VOT.V. MVLT.X no column m. M. Illegible, but type possibly Lyons mint. Surface find from field.
R. R Clarke (NCM).
Tetricus I (S2) V.ii407, no.56 AE AD 270-3. Obverse; IMP.C.TETRICVS P.F.AVG. Reverse: COMES AVG Victory standing to the left holding wreath and palm. Surface find from field.
